A business analyst software is responsible for analyzing and understanding the requirements of an organization and translating them into functional specifications for software development. They work closely with stakeholders, such as clients, project managers, and software developers, to gather and document business requirements, identify gaps and propose solutions. They conduct feasibility studies, create process models, and define system requirements to ensure that the software meets the needs of the organization. Additionally, they may assist in user acceptance testing, provide training and support to end-users, and participate in post-implementation reviews.

Business Analyst Software salary in Norway
Average Yearly Salary of Business Analyst Software in Norway is approximately 1,459,442 NOK (132,302 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Norway, located in Northern Europe, is a country known for its stunning natural landscapes, including fjords, mountains, and forests. With a population of approximately 5.4 million people, it is one of the least densely populated countries in Europe. The size of Norway is around 323,802 square kilometers, making it larger than many European countries.
